Public Information Officers

The Broomfield Police Department routinely utilizes social media to disseminate information to the public. Please go directly to our Facebook and Twitter accounts for the most up-to-date information. You can also follow us on Nextdoor and on YouTube.

The Broomfield Police Department utilizes a team of public information officers. They are responsible for meeting with the press, addressing any inquiries from the media, and serving as the voice of the department. 

The on-call public information officer can be reached 24 hours a day, seven days a week through the Communications Center (dispatch) at 303-438-6400. You can also email Lead Public Information Officer Rachel Haslett (Welte) (does not always respond to email on weekends and holidays).
